PS5 players who want cleaner online matches in Marvel Tokon: Fighting Souls can stop being paired with PC opponents by switching off Cross Play. The PC version currently runs into lag, stuttering, and frame-rate drops, and because Cross Play mixes both platforms into the same matchmaking pool, a stable PS5 session can inherit those problems whenever it connects to a struggling PC player.

Quick answer: Open OPTIONS from the main menu, go to the Online Settings tab, and turn Cross Play off. From that point, matchmaking will only connect you with other PS5 players.


Why PS5 players are disabling Cross Play

The PS5 build is the more stable way to play right now. The PC version has drawn “Mixed” reviews on Steam, with players pointing to performance issues that carry over into online play. Cross Play is a core feature meant to let PS5 and PC fans fight each other, but that same connection can drag a smooth PS5 match into the stutter and input problems affecting the PC side.

A Day 1 update addressed several concerns raised during the open beta, including control input optimization, reduced input lag, and lower CPU load. Those changes helped, but they did not resolve everything. Arc System Works has confirmed that more performance fixes are on the way, so turning off Cross Play is a way to protect your online experience until the PC build catches up.


Turn off Cross Play on PS5

From the main menu, move the cursor down to OPTIONS and select it. This is the same menu that holds System, Graphics, Audio, and Accessibility settings.
At the top of the Options screen, move across the horizontal tabs and choose Online Settings. Cross Play lives here rather than under the control or graphics tabs.
Set the Cross Play option to off. Back out of the menu to save the change, then start searching for a match as normal.

How to confirm it worked

Once Cross Play is off, matchmaking is restricted to the PS5 pool only. You will no longer be queued into sessions with PC players, which removes the risk of picking up their stutter, lag, or frame-rate drops mid-match. If the toggle still reads as on when you return to Online Settings, it did not save, so set it again before backing out.


What you give up by disabling Cross Play

Cross Play settingWho you can match withTrade-off
OnPS5 and PC playersLarger pool, but risk of inheriting PC performance issues
OffPS5 players onlyMore stable matches, but a smaller pool to search

Note: Cutting the pool to PS5 only can mean fewer available opponents, so keep that in mind if you rely on a fast queue. If you want the widest possible matchmaking again later, you can turn Cross Play back on from the same Online Settings tab, especially after Arc System Works ships the additional PC performance fixes it has confirmed.
